The steel wire rope core conveyor belt (commonly categorized by tensile class standards from ST500 to ST5400) represents the apex of material handling engineering. Unlike textile plied belts, the primary load carrier consists of a coplanar array of high-tensile, zinc-galvanized steel cords. The cord structure is specifically designed with alternating left- and right-hand lays to guarantee absolute tracking straightness.

Underground mines require vertical lifting and steep decline conveyor systems. Our high-tension ST core belts carry dense run-of-mine ores safely, with certified flame-retardant properties to prevent fire hazards in tight mining chambers.
Ship loaders run continuously, handling abrasive coal, iron ore, and grain. Our wear-resistant cover rubber grade (DIN X/Y or AS Grade A) withstands constant high-speed friction and salt-laden sea air, extending overall belt life.
Conveying superheated sinter, clinker, and slag demands thermal defense. We offer specialized heat-resistant steel cord belts that maintain structural adhesion even when handling materials up to 400°C.

The global mining sector is shifting away from reactive maintenance. Modern steel wire rope conveyor belts integrate smart RFID tags and continuous induction sensor loops. These systems run alongside conveyor structures, tracking belt thickness, lateral drift, and cord breakage. If a foreign object punctures the belt and splits the sensor circuit, the drive system halts in seconds, preventing catastrophic failure and minimizing repair downtime.
Overland conveyor systems spanning several kilometers require massive electrical power. Up to 60% of this energy is consumed by the continuous indentation resistance of the belt over idlers. Boao is developing Low Rolling Resistance (LRR) rubber compounds for the bottom cover. By reducing viscoelastic losses, these energy-saving compounds cut power consumption on flat conveyor segments by 10% to 15%, reducing operating costs and carbon footprints.
